在JavaScript日志中出现404错误通常意味着请求的资源未找到。这可能是由于多种原因造成的,比如URL拼写错误、资源已被移除、服务器配置问题或者网络问题。以下是一些解决404错误的步骤:
-
检查URL:
- 确保请求的URL是正确的,并且没有拼写错误。
- 如果URL是动态生成的,检查生成URL的代码逻辑是否正确。
-
检查资源是否存在:
- 确认你请求的资源(如页面、图片、脚本文件等)确实存在于服务器上。
- 如果资源已被移除或重命名,请更新引用该资源的代码。
-
检查服务器配置:
- 如果你有权访问服务器配置文件(如Apache的
.htaccess
文件或Nginx的配置文件),检查是否有重写规则导致资源无法正确映射。
- 确保服务器配置允许访问请求的资源类型。
-
检查网络连接:
- 确认客户端和服务器之间的网络连接是正常的。
- 如果你在本地开发环境中遇到404错误,尝试清除浏览器缓存或使用不同的浏览器测试。
-
查看服务器日志:
- 服务器日志可能会提供更多关于404错误的详细信息,比如请求的资源路径、客户端IP地址等。
- 根据日志中的信息,进一步定位问题所在。
-
检查JavaScript代码:
- 如果404错误是由JavaScript代码中的AJAX请求引起的,确保请求的URL是正确的,并且服务器端能够正确处理该请求。
- 检查是否有跨域请求的问题,如果有的话,确保服务器端已经正确配置了CORS(跨源资源共享)。
-
使用开发者工具:
- 打开浏览器的开发者工具(通常可以通过按F12或右键点击页面元素选择“检查”来打开)。
- 切换到“网络”标签页,重新加载页面,并查看与404错误相关的请求。
- 检查请求的详细信息,如请求头、响应头、响应体等,以获取更多线索。
通过以上步骤,你应该能够定位并解决JavaScript日志中的404错误。如果问题仍然存在,可能需要进一步检查代码逻辑或寻求专业人士的帮助。